算法描述 大多数情况下,在三种简单排序中,插入排序都是最优的选择。虽然插入排序算法仍需要 O(N^2) 的时间,但在一般情况下,它要比冒泡排序快一倍,比选择排序还要快一点。插入排序可以简单表述为:使“标定项”的一侧局部有序,每次将标定项插入有序一侧,同时将另一侧的下一项设为“标定项”。 代码部分 / ...
分类:
编程语言 时间:
2020-06-16 23:25:17
阅读次数:
70
介绍 触发器是与表有关的数据库对象,在满足定义条件时触发,并执行触发器中定义的语句集合。 触发器的特性: 1、有begin end体,begin end;之间的语句可以写的简单或者复杂 2、什么条件会触发:I、D、U 3、什么时候触发:在增删改前或者后(before/after) 4、触发频率:针对 ...
分类:
数据库 时间:
2020-06-16 00:31:43
阅读次数:
63
要说逻辑其实也不难,新建一个form表单,表单有action处理页面,action页面就是处理上传的页面,这个dropzone插件的任务就是帮你对上传的文件进行列队上传,就像管理员:你们这群孩子,领奖状就要排好队,一次上n个(默认是2个,可配置)来领奖,后面的同学排好队,等待领奖。并且监听每一个文件 ...
分类:
Web程序 时间:
2020-06-15 14:01:27
阅读次数:
53
自定义管理表单 通过使用来注册Question模型admin.site.register(Question),Django能够构建默认的表单表示形式。 通常,您需要自定义管理表单的外观和工作方式。您可以通过在注册对象时告诉Django所需的选项来做到这一点。 让我们通过重新排列编辑表单中的字段来查看 ...
分类:
其他好文 时间:
2020-06-14 19:07:08
阅读次数:
63
mongodb是一个基于分布式文件存储的数据库,由C++语言编写。它旨在为WEB应用提供可扩展的高性能数据存储解决方案,最大的特点是支持的查询语言非常强大,其语法有点类似于面向对象的查询语言,几乎可以实现类似关系数据库单表查询的绝大部分功能,而且还支持对数据建立索引。本文鉴于MongoDB强大丰富功 ...
分类:
数据库 时间:
2020-06-14 11:03:33
阅读次数:
76
本节重点: 单表查询 语法: 一、单表查询的语法 SELECT 字段1,字段2... FROM 表名 WHERE 条件 GROUP BY field HAVING 筛选 ORDER BY field LIMIT 限制条数 二、关键字的执行优先级(重点) 重点中的重点:关键字的执行优先级 from w ...
分类:
其他好文 时间:
2020-06-13 23:36:19
阅读次数:
95
数据库1-初始数据库 MYSQL_1 mysql支持的数据类型 数据库2-表操作 数据库3-记录操作 单表查询 多表查询 mysql索引原理 MySQL练习题参考答案 使用python操作mysql数据库 mysql其他 mysql性能分析之explain pymongo模块 mongoDB pyt ...
分类:
数据库 时间:
2020-06-13 12:59:55
阅读次数:
86
1、问题描述 今天 QQ群里在讨论一个问题,在某个环境里面,需要修改单个表的多个字段,造成了数据混乱,跟理想修改的数据不一致。 1.1 模拟问题现象 # 注意: 创建的表没有主键,且 t1 表是 innodb 引擎 root@localhost [keme]>create table t1 (a i ...
分类:
其他好文 时间:
2020-06-13 00:28:01
阅读次数:
60
一、前言 分布式系统中我们会对一些数据量大的业务进行分拆,如:用户表,订单表。因为数据量巨大一张表无法承接,就会对其进行分库分表。 但一旦涉及到分库分表,就会引申出分布式系统中唯一主键ID的生成问题,永不迁移数据和避免热点的文章中要求需要唯一ID的特性: 整个系统ID唯一 ID是数字类型,而且是趋势 ...
分类:
其他好文 时间:
2020-06-11 19:46:02
阅读次数:
51
OGG进程拆分(单表拆成多个进程) 概要:《OGG进程拆分》介绍了如何将一个入库进程中的多个表拆分到其他进程中。本篇将着重介绍如何使用多个进程同时入库一张表。适用条件:1)入库进程只同步一张表,但仍有延时2)目标段主机CPU、内存压力不大,以便有足够的资源添加新的入库进程 本示例将RZG_CXI2中 ...
分类:
其他好文 时间:
2020-06-11 18:13:28
阅读次数:
94